HCR 13, 79th R.S.
Memorializing Congress to allow Mexican visitors the same six-month length of stay afforded to Canadian travelers.

Last action: Signed by the Governor

Author: Norma Chavez
Joint Author: Rene Oliveira | Sylvester Turner | Vilma Luna | Joaquin Castro
